Ok.. let me see if I understood correctly after browsing through many topics about the modern vs 50s wiring.

This is my les paul control cavity:



It has the modern wiring. If I want to change to 50s, all I have to do is change the tone cap end to the vol pot center plug?

Thanks in advace..
If you have modern wiring and then swap cap over to center lug on volume pot you will have what is known here at MLPF as "Hybrid" 50's wiring. For the complete version you would also need so solder the middle lug of Tone pot back to case and use outside lug for cap lead.

I have found that it is not so crital how Tone pot is wired, but how the cap connects to volume pot. Outside lug on volume is where your pu lead solders in(modern) the middle lug is where switch lead connects (50's wiring) connecting cap lead to center lug will give you a little more treble and also keep Tone from being muddy when you turn volume down.

You can compare these two diagrams. I found that my 06' Gibson LP Studio sounded better and thicker with the Modern wiring, it varies from guitar to guitar according to a poll I did here at MLPF
